About this episode
This episode explores the importance of noticing and being aware of the small details in life that often go unnoticed.
In this episode, we explore the art of noticing. The quiet skill of paying attention to what usually slips past us. From living on autopilot to missing small signals in our relationships, work, and inner lives, this conversation is a gentle reminder that clarity begins with awareness. As the new year starts, this episode invites you to slow down, listen more closely, and notice the patterns shaping your life before they become problems. Happy New Year Music: Saxophone Rufus
